We Have Been Supporting IT Conferences Like PyCon for Years

Despite our long-term success at TITANS, we haven’t forgotten our roots. The company’s CEOs Marek Greško and Róbert Dusík worked as programmers before the company was founded and, in addition to their traditional jobs, they also experienced a freelance life full of independence and frequent changes. This experience in the IT sector inspired them to improve the conditions for people who choose to freelance.

As a company, even after all these years, we are naturally drawn to IT events with lectures full of the latest expertise and excellent workshops focusing on practical skills. PyCon, the event of the year for all Pythonists, is one of our cherished conferences, that we have supported for a long time. We feel at home there and we knew that after a one-year hiatus, the event would be even more spectacular than before.

Once again, Marek and Róbert had the honour of officially opening PyCon with their speeches. They highlighted how the work of IT programmers is often invisible and taken for granted, even though it is demanding and requires continuous learning. “For me and us at TITANS, you are all heroes behind the curtain who make the world a better and safer place,” Marek stressed. “We are very proud to be here with you for the fourth time,” agreed Róbert.

Apart From Sports, We Also Like the Marathon of Questions

Our survey at the conference revealed that most attendees prefer the career benefits that come with freelancing. What are the advantages of freelancing? And what is the demand for Python programmers? The topics were covered by our Key Account Manager, Michal Brandis, who also shared practical tips from the current IT market. As usual, his lecture provoked many, or as the host described it, a “marathon” of insightful questions. We then asked the audience our questions via the popular Kahoot quiz, which selected the winner of the Titans package.
